The formula for the area of a trapezoid is:
A= (a+b)/2*h
A=150
h=10
b=14
a=?
So we need to solve for a. Let's plug in the values that we do know...
A= (a+b)/2*h
150=(a+14)/2*10
150=(a/2+14/2)*10
150=(a/2+7)*10
Divide both sides by 10
15=a/2+7
subtract 7 from both sides
8=a/2
multiply both sides by 2
16=a
The other base is 16

Answer:
x = 9, y = 2 is the solution of the given system.
Step-by-step explanation:
Here, the given set of equation is :
2 x - 3 y = 12
x = 4 y + 1
Now, from equation (2) we see that x = 4 y + 1.
Substitute the value of y from (2) in the first equation. we get:
2 x - 3 y = 12 ⇒ 2 (4 y + 1) - 3 y = 12
or, 8 y + 2 - 3 y = 12
or, 5 y = 12- 2 = 10
or, y = 10/ 5 = 2
or, y = 2
Now, x = 4 y + 1 ⇒ x = 4(2) + 1 = 8 + 1 = 9, or x = 9
Hence, x = 9, y = 2 is the solution of the given system.
